1970 Camaro Prototype Concept
Based on the 1st Generation Camaro platform, this is a styling exercise using what became the roof and rear end of the 2nd Generation Camaro.
The rear panel & roof/trunk is from an AMT ’70 Camaro, the main body is the Revell ‘69. The rear window frame was rescribed and sanded flush. The rear door lines were filled and new ones were scribed. ![]() ![]()

Re: 1970 Camaro Prototype Concept
The rear bumper was too narrow, I don’t know if it is a problem with the AMT ’70 Camaro or something I did during the body modification since I did not test fit it until the body was re-worked, but it needed about 1/8th of an inch added.
![]() BMF to re-plate it… ![]() The rear corners of the body also had to be tweaked and built up to meet the bumper, the corners were a bit “soft”. |

Re: 1970 Camaro Prototype Concept
The wheels from the AMT kit were the style I wanted to use, but needed some modifications to be used with the Revell tires, and they were not 100% correct, so thinned them out on the lathe…
![]() ![]() And machined a set of beauty rings… ![]() I was able to reuse the center caps after I cut some discs from aluminum to close off the open center portions of the wheels. And some hex rod was sliced up for the lug nuts… Dark gunmetal with some silver accents and they are ready to install…

Re: 1970 Camaro Prototype Concept
Start in the middle and "massage" the BMF on to the part, it stretches pretty well. Toothpicks and Q-tips can help too; I just use my fingers and watch for wrinkles about to form. If they are about to form, just peel up the loose part of the foil to allow it to “flow” on to the part.
Silver was the only color in my mind for this car. Not a big fan of silver for body color, but it fits with the history of Chevy’s concept cars… Mica Silver with Pearl Clear…
